上皮性卵巢癌中微管驱动蛋白KIF2 A的表达及其意义

摘要

目的 检测微管驱动蛋白KIF2A及其mRNA在卵巢癌中的表达情况,检测转染KIF2A-siRNA卵巢癌细胞(HO-8910)在迁移和侵袭能力方面的变化,探讨KIF2A在卵巢癌细胞恶性行为中所起的作用.方法 应用免疫组织化学方法检测了KIF2A在30例卵巢癌和20例卵巢正常组织中的表达,同时应用逆转录-聚合酶链反应(RT-PCR)法检测了KIF2A mRNA的表达情况.体外培养HO-8910,KIF2A-siRNA干扰KIF2A表达后,应用RT-PCR和Western 印迹检测细胞系中KIF2A表达变化;分别用细胞划痕、transwell 的实验方法检测干扰KIF2A作用后对细胞迁移和侵袭行为的影响.结果 KIF2A在卵巢癌中的表达显著高于正常卵巢组织(P<0.05);KIF2A-siRNA干扰后,HO-8910中KIF2A mRNA及蛋白水平显著下调(P<0.05),细胞迁移和侵袭能力被显著抑制(P<0.05).结论 KIF2A在卵巢癌组织中表达升高,干扰KIF2A基因的表达可抑制卵巢癌细胞的迁移和侵袭能力,提示KIF2A基因可能成为干预卵巢癌发展的新靶点.%Objective To investigate the protein and mRNA expression of KIF 2A in ovarian cancer,and to investigate the migration and invasion ability changes in ovarian cancer cell line HO -8910 transfected by KIF2A-siRNA.Methods Immunohistochemical method was used to detect the expression of KIF2A in 30 cases of ovarian cancer and 20 cases of ovarian normal tissues.The expression of KIF2A mRNA was detected by RT-PCR.The mRNA and protein expression of KIF2A in cell line HO-8910 was detected by RT-PCR and Western blot after transfected by KIF 2A-siRNA in vitro.After the transfection, the cell migration and invasion ability were observed by scratch test and transwell experiments.Result The expression of KIF2A mRNA and protein in HO-8910 was significantly lower than that in normal ovarian tissue (P<0.05).The capacities of migration and invasion of HO-8910 was suppressed notably after the knockdown of KIF2A(P<0.05).Conclusion KIF2A gene expression was increased in ovarian cancer, and knockdown of KIF2A gene can inhibit the migration and invasion of ovarian cancer cells.It suggested that KIF2A gene may be a new target for the development of ovarian cancer.
